Defense
The Defense Department relies on advanced IT and cybersecurity systems to maintain its technological edge and ensure national security. This includes securing vast networks, protecting sensitive data, and developing cutting-edge technologies. The Pentagon is also responsible for defending against cyber threats from state-sponsored actors and non-state actors, which requires constant vigilance and innovation. DOD invests in research and development, as well as training and education for its personnel.
